Walkthrough
  1. 1
    Assess the Monster: Don't charge in immediately. Stay defensive and observe the monster's movements to understand its attack patterns before engaging fully.
  2. 2
    Observe Monster Behavior: Pay attention to signs of exhaustion (drooling, fins flat, failed spit attacks) and agitation (roaring, increased speed, and attack during Rage Mode). Learn to recognize subtle and obvious tells before monster attacks.
  3. 3
    Utilize Your Items: Use traps to immobilize enraged monsters, Flash Bombs to ground flying monsters, and Mega Dash Juice for stamina. Be versatile with your equipment and weapons, considering different elements and styles.
  4. 4
    Research is Key: Consult guides, research monster statistics, weapon trees, and armor skills. Going in blind can be fun, but research ensures better preparation and success.
  5. 5
    Embrace Failure: Don't be discouraged by failing quests (triple carting). Analyze what led to failure (e.g., over-aggression, poor positioning) and adjust your strategy for future attempts. Learn from mistakes to find a balance between offense and defense.
  6. 6
    Use the Terrain: Utilize ledges and walls for jump attacks to mount monsters. Successfully mounting allows for free hits. During a mount, repeatedly press X to fill the gauge, and hold R to hold on during the monster's struggles.
